冠县信息港 > > 正文
2025 01/ 07 18:46:26
来源:一笔勾断

AI工程文件格式详解:含义与应用

字体:

内容简介

在当今快速发展的数字时代人工智能()技术已经成为科技领域中更具变革性的力量之一。随着技术的不断进步和应用范围的扩大工程文件格式的关键性日益凸显。工程文件格式是用于存储和传输实习小编、数据集以及其他相关资源的标准格式。它们不仅决定了数据的结构化表示方法还作用了系统的开发效率、兼容性和可扩展性。 理解不同类型的工程文件格式及其应用场景对从事研究和开发的专业人士而言至关关键。本文将详细介绍几种常见的工程文件格式,包含但不限于ONNX、TensorFlow SavedModel和PyTorch TorchScript,并探讨它们各自的优点、缺点以及适用场景。咱们还将讨论工程文件格式的打包方法,帮助读者更好地管理和部署项目。

AI工程文件格式详解:含义与应用

工程文件格式是什么意思?

AI工程文件格式详解:含义与应用

AI工程文件格式详解:含义与应用

工程文件格式是一种特定的数据结构,用于定义和组织实习小编、数据集及其他相关信息。此类格式保障了数据的一致性和标准化,使得不同系统之间的互操作性成为可能。例如,ONNX(Open Neural Network Exchange)是一种开放式的交换格式,它允许不同框架之间共享训练好的神经网络模型。ONNX格式的核心优势在于其可以促进跨平台的模型部署,使得开发者可以在不同的硬件和软件环境中采用相同的模型。另一个例子是TensorFlow SavedModel,它是Google的TensorFlow框架推荐的一种模型导出格式。SavedModel不仅包含了模型本身的结构和权重还包含了一套完整的服务接口,使得模型可被直接加载并实施推理任务。通过熟悉各种工程文件格式的含义咱们能够更好地选择合适的工具和方法来构建高效、可维护的系统。

AI工程文件格式详解:含义与应用

AI工程文件格式详解:含义与应用

工程文件格式怎样去打包

工程文件格式的打包是指将模型及其相关资源(如配置文件、预解决脚本等)整合成一个统一的包,以便于分发和部署。打包过程不仅需要考虑文件格式的选择,还需要考虑到压缩、加密和版本控制等因素。选择合适的文件格式是关键步骤之一。例如,对TensorFlow模型,可利用SavedModel格式实施打包;而对PyTorch模型,则可利用TorchScript或TorchScript Bundle格式。在打包进展中多数情况下会采用压缩算法(如gzip或zip)来减小文件大小,升级传输效率。为了保护模型的知识产权和安全性,还能够对打包后的文件实行加密解决。 版本控制系统(如Git)可帮助管理不同版本的模型文件,保证团队协作中的数据一致性。通过合理的打包策略,不仅可提升模型的可移植性,还能简化后续的部署流程,为大规模应用奠定坚实的基础。

AI工程文件格式详解:含义与应用

AI工程文件格式详解:含义与应用

【纠错】 【责任编辑:一笔勾断】
阅读下一篇:

Copyright © 2000 - 2023 All Rights Reserved.

鲁ICP备17033019号-1.